Billie Bullock compiled a career batting average of .282 with 15 home runs and 0 RBI in his 315-game career with the Fond du Lac Panthers, Joplin Miners, St. Joseph Saints, Norfolk Tars, Binghamton Triplets and Quincy Gems. He began playing during the 1950 season and last took the field during the 1955 campaign.
